Note From an Occupier

I have been part of the Occupy Buffalo movement since October 17. One of the features that fascinates me is the cordial relationship we enjoy with the Buffalo Police and Fire Departments, Erie County Sheriff’s Office, the media, and City Hall, in contrast to the constant clashes reported in Oakland, Chicago, Atlanta, or even nearby Rochester. We are a peaceful movement, seeking to alter people’s perceptions and illusions about the broken American Dream, alert them to the fact that the 99 percent of us pay taxes whereas the very rich (known as the one percenters) squirrel their money away into tax shelters.
